York City beat Havant and Waterlooville 2-0 at Kitkat Crescent to go through to the semi-finals of the FA Trophy.
Goals from York City striker Daniel McBreen booked the Blue Square Premier club's place in the next round.
The Australian born forward scored in the 45th and 82nd minute to give York their second appearance in the semi-finals in two seasons.
The first leg of the semi-finals takes place on Saturday 14 March with the second leg a week later.
